超图 球不显示问题

0 投票

环境变量 64位等都设置了  为啥就是球不显示

11月 18, 2019 分类:  93次浏览 | 用户: 火车头1 (8 分)

1个回答

0 投票
您好,你加载的是平面场景吧,要加载球需要球面场景
11月 18, 2019 用户: 邬袁凯 名扬四海 (2,429 分)
你好  我是加载的三维场景,前端时间我笔记本可以加载出来,我把代码迁移到台式机上 台式机始终无法显示三维球,不知道怎么回事
把你代码发出来看一下,这个是三维平面场景的
this.m_sceneControl = new SceneControl(SceneType.NonEarthFlat);
m_sceneControl.Dock = DockStyle.Fill;

   try
            {
                // 添加三维控件到窗体
                // Add the SceneControl to the form
                panel1.Controls.Add(m_sceneControl);
                panel1.Controls.SetChildIndex(m_sceneControl, 0);

                // 实例化SampleRun
                // Initialize a new instance of SampleRun
                m_sampleRun = new SampleRun(m_sceneControl);
                m_sampleRun.m_formMain = this;
                m_sampleRun.mainWindow = MainWin;

            }
            catch (Exception ex)
            {
                Trace.WriteLine(ex.Message);
            }
改成scenetype.Globe
真是这个问题  出来了 谢谢

你好 现在遇到一个问题 就是加载缓存文件,笔记本上可以加载显示出管廊模型,台式机就是不显示 也不报错  代码如下

看下路径哈,缓存路径和工作空间路径,你可以在台式机上这样操作,把你的工作空间和缓存文件放在一个文件夹下面,然后拷贝到笔记本上的时候拷贝整个文件,这样就不会破坏相对路径了
...